Highly-detailed OO gauge model, 1:76.2 scale on 16.5mm track
* Minimum Radius 438mm (2nd Radius Set-track)
* Weight 40g minimum
* Die-cast chassis for ideal weight
* Detailed interior with rivets, framing, strapping and accurately profiled door 'horns'
* RP25-110 profile OO gauge wheels with separate brake blocks in line with tread
* 26mm axle length
* Sprung metal buffers and dummy instanter couplings
* Super fine plastic parts, incl. air pipes, lamp irons, safety catches, clasp and disc brakes, hopper door operating equipment, etc.
* Etched metal details, incl. brake lever, chassis plates, etc.
* Removable, Kinetic NEM coupler mounts at correct height with mini-tension-lock couplers provided with scale Instanters included

Accurascale has released a new set of three OO gauge models of MHA Coalfish wagons in EWS livery. The models are highly detailed and feature a die-cast chassis for added weight. The wagons are designed for use on 16.5mm track and have a minimum radius of 438mm. They are supplied with sprung metal buffers and dummy Instanter couplings.
Each model is finished in a pristine maroon livery and features accurate details such as rivets, framing, and strapping. The interior of the wagons is also detailed, with accurately profiled door 'horns'. The models have RP25-110 profile OO gauge wheels with separate brake blocks and are designed for easy conversion to EM and P4 gauge track.
The wagons are based on the real-life MHA Coalfish wagons built by various manufacturers between 1997 and 2007 for the English, Welsh and Scottish Railway. The models are available in wagon numbers 394531, 394716, and 394941. They are suitable for use on OO gauge layouts depicting the initial privatisation era of British Rail.
